Pan-Turkism in Action? Turkic Nationalists, Nazi Germany and Turkey During World War ii

Turkish Historical Review, 2023
Abstract For Pan-Turkists, the Nazi German attack on the Soviet Union in June 1941 seemed to offer a chance for the liberation of Turkic peoples from Soviet domination. Consequently, they attempted to win over both the Turkish and the Nazi German governments to support their aims. Although active Pan-Turkist policies—entailing entry into the war on the
